My Dear Secretary (Alpha) (1948)
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
Kirk Douglas plays best-selling novelist Owen Waterbury, an inveterate ladies man and diehard skirt-chaser. When gorgeous aspiring novelist Stephanie Gaylord (Laraine Day) becomes his secretary, he envisions yet another notch on his bedpost. She is not easily won over, however, and Waterbury soon finds himself in the unique position of wanting to live up to her high standards and leave his playboy days behind him. They marry, and the fun begins when his new wife discovers that his replacement secretary is also quite charming, intelligent, and beautiful. Can she trust him?
